    Context

    ezyVet is an established cloud veterinary platform with a wide footprint in mid-size and corporate practice groups, particularly in Australia, New Zealand, and the United Kingdom. PetChart is a newer cloud platform focused on AI-assisted documentation, transparent pricing, and faster onboarding for clinics that want a modern stack without the implementation burden typical of enterprise rollouts. Practices evaluating both are usually weighing depth of established integrations against speed of getting live and the value of integrated AI scribing.

    Migration Considerations

    Data Migration Path

    Patient records, client list, vaccination history, and accounting data need a documented migration path that preserves historical context for clinical and financial continuity.

    Team Training Approach

    Software change is a team-change project. PetChart provides role-based onboarding paths (front desk, technician, veterinarian, owner) rather than expecting everyone to take the same generic training.

    Integrations You Depend On

    Map current third-party tools — labs, payment processors, accounting — to PetChart's integration set before switching to avoid mid-migration surprises.

    Reporting Continuity

    Practices using custom reporting in their current system should sample equivalent reports in PetChart and confirm the data model maps cleanly.
